Creating a broadcasting studio that meets modern standards requires a balanced blend of technology, space optimization, and practical organization. As the demand for high-quality broadcasting content grows, so does the need for updated equipment and strategic planning within the studio space.

This guide covers the essentials to set up a well-rounded studio that meets professional standards, facilitating seamless broadcasts.

Essential Equipment for High-Quality Broadcasting

Selecting the right equipment is crucial for a professional broadcasting studio. From reliable video cameras to microphones, each piece contributes to the overall production quality. Video cameras with 4K resolution capability are ideal for capturing clear, high-definition visuals that audiences expect. Built-in Wi-Fi can be an added advantage, allowing easy file transfer and remote control, thus saving time during setup.

Ikan studio broadcasting equipment offers versatile tools for this purpose, including teleprompters, LED lighting, and other essential accessories. These components are designed to adapt to various broadcasting needs, making it easier to capture sharp visuals and improve production quality.

Teleprompters, for instance, allow presenters to maintain eye contact with the camera while delivering lines seamlessly, enhancing the professional appeal of the broadcast.

In terms of lighting, adjustable LED panels are ideal for minimizing shadows and enhancing on-camera appearances. Sound equipment such as dynamic microphones helps in capturing clear audio by reducing background noise, while audio mixers provide fine control over sound levels. Together, these components establish a strong foundation for high-quality broadcasting.

Optimizing Your Space for Broadcast Needs

Before finalizing your equipment choices, consider the studio’s layout and how it impacts the quality of the broadcast. A well-thought-out setup enhances workflow and improves both audio and video clarity, creating a seamless environment for production.

Prioritizing space optimization allows for easy movement within the studio, which is particularly beneficial during live broadcasts or when quick adjustments are necessary.

Soundproofing is essential to prevent external noise from affecting the broadcast. Acoustic foam panels, bass traps, and diffusers can significantly reduce echoes and improve sound quality, contributing to a professional audio output.

Additionally, arranging equipment and furniture to allow clear sightlines between presenters and cameras ensures fluid movement and uninterrupted communication among team members.

Lighting also plays a critical role in the setup. Using a combination of soft, diffused light sources, such as LED lights with adjustable brightness and color temperature, can reduce harsh shadows and produce natural-looking visuals.

Thoughtfully placed lighting not only enhances on-camera appearance but reduces the need for extensive post-production editing, leading to a smoother and more efficient production process.

Setting Up Efficient Sound and Video Control Systems

Sound and video control systems form the core of any broadcasting studio. They enable smooth transitions, precise audio adjustments, and real-time video effects, all essential for high-quality productions.

When arranging your control room, prioritize easy access to every device, ensuring quick adjustments during live sessions.

A high-quality audio interface is particularly valuable, especially when working with multiple microphones. This device connects all microphones to the main computer, ensuring clear audio quality for live broadcasts. For video control, consider software that supports live switching between cameras and adding visual effects. Many studios benefit from control panels with customizable buttons, allowing for quick access to essential commands.

Dual monitors can also improve the control room’s functionality. With one screen dedicated to monitoring the live broadcast and the other managing control settings, operators have the flexibility to oversee and adjust the output simultaneously. This arrangement proves invaluable, especially in fast-paced, live settings.

Creating a Seamless Workflow for Broadcasting

Organizing the broadcasting workflow to minimize downtime is essential for a modern studio. Start by establishing a pre-production checklist that includes equipment checks, sound tests, and lighting adjustments to catch any issues before they impact the broadcast. Regular maintenance routines for equipment can further prevent unexpected interruptions during critical broadcasts, ensuring smoother productions.

Clearly defined roles for each team member—whether operating the camera, managing sound, or handling post-production—improve efficiency and communication. Integrating broadcasting software that simplifies transitions, overlays, and real-time editing is also helpful for maintaining a polished final output. Some studios use automation tools for repetitive tasks, such as saving files and managing storage, which not only streamlines workflow but also makes it easier to archive past broadcasts for future reference and reuse.

Final Touches and Post-Production Essentials

The post-production phase is where the final polish is added to broadcasts, refining audio, adjusting color, and adding effects. Quality editing software allows for color correction, audio alignment, and smooth transitions, enhancing the visual and auditory appeal of the production. Incorporating audio balancing tools can also ensure consistency in sound levels, preventing unexpected volume spikes that might disrupt viewer engagement.

Adding visual elements like lower thirds, titles, and transitions not only helps in branding but also creates a more immersive experience for the audience. Additionally, automated captioning tools can improve accessibility, broadening the audience reach and making the content suitable for viewers with hearing impairments.

Staying Current with Broadcasting Technology

Broadcasting technology continues to evolve, making it essential for studios to stay updated with the latest developments. Subscribing to industry news, participating in online courses, and attending trade shows are effective ways to stay informed, gain insights on emerging equipment, and ensure the studio remains competitive.

By networking with other professionals and learning from industry leaders, studios can adopt best practices and new technologies that enhance production quality.

Keeping up with technology trends also allows broadcasters to continuously enhance their setup, incorporating innovations such as AI-driven editing tools, real-time analytics, and cloud-based storage solutions.

These upgrades can significantly improve workflow, reduce production time, and lead to higher-quality productions that meet industry standards and audience expectations. Staying adaptable to new technologies helps studios maintain a modern edge, appealing to a tech-savvy audience and ensuring content remains relevant and engaging.

All in all, setting up a modern broadcasting studio involves strategic planning, from choosing the right equipment to organizing an efficient layout. With reliable components and a well-structured space, studios can achieve high-quality, professional broadcasts.

By following these essentials, you’ll be well-equipped to create engaging content that resonates with audiences and meets broadcasting standards.
